#2 - My JavaScript Path
Após o embasamento no front-end, focado em HTML/CSS, é hora de focar no JavaScript, tanto para front, quanto para back-end.
Este plano de estudos abrange, em ordem de estudos¹, essas duas vertentes:
- Se você deseja aprofundar no JS para Front-End, assista os cursos da primeira metade deste plano, até o curso JavaScript: salvando dados localmente com IndexedDb.
- A partir desse ponto, os cursos e artigos tendem a ser mais voltados ao JS para Back-End com foco também em Node.js.
Depois disso, você já tem uma base bem legal pra seguir no aprendizado de algum framework ou biblioteca, como Angular, Vue ou React. E falando em React, caso este seja seu próximo passo, basta acessar o plano de estudos #3 - My React Roadmap.
Bons estudos!
¹ A ordem de estudos desse plano é uma opinião pessoal. Foi a forma que eu achei mais didática de evoluir os conhecimentos. Você pode seguir este plano de estudos na ordem que achar mais apropriada para o seu aprendizado! :)
Planos de estudo são sequências de cursos e outros conteúdos criados por alunos e alunas da Alura para organizar seus estudos. Siga planos que te interessem ou crie o seu próprio.
Passo a passo
- 
                            1Conteúdo do plano- 
            
                
                
                
                
                    
                        Artigo JavaScript: o que é, como aprender e Guia da linguagem | Alura
- 
            
                
                
                
                
                    
                        Curso Lógica de programação: mergulhe em programação com JavaScript
- 
            
                
                
                
                
                    
                        Curso JavaScript: utilizando tipos, variáveis e funções
- 
            
                
                
                
                
                    
                        Artigo Entenda a diferença entre var, let e const no JavaScript
- 
            
                
                
                
                
                    
                        Formação Desenvolvimento Front-end: cursos para criar aplicações web com HTML, CSS e JavaScript
- 
            
                
                
                
                
                    
                        Curso JavaScript: validações e reconhecimento de voz
- 
            
                
                
                
                
                    
                        Curso JavaScript: explorando a linguagem
- 
            
                
                
                
                
                    
                        Curso JavaScript: manipulando objetos
- 
            
                
                
                
                
                    
                        Curso JavaScript: de padrões a uma abordagem funcional
- 
            
                
                
                
                
                    
                        Curso Expressões Regulares: faça buscas, validações e substituições de textos
- 
            
                
                
                
                
                    
                        Formação Desenvolva aplicações Web em JavaScript com tarefas concorrentes e orientadas a objetos
- 
            
                
                
                
                
                    
                        Formação Aprenda a programar em JavaScript com foco no back-end
- 
            
                
                
                
                
                    
                        Video 10 MÉTODOS DE ARRAY QUE TODO DESENVOLVEDOR PRECISA CONHECER - YouTube
- 
            
                
                
                
                
                    
                        Curso JavaScript: programando a Orientação a Objetos
- 
            
                
                
                
                
                    
                        Curso JavaScript: interfaces e Herança em Orientação a Objetos
- 
            
                
                
                
                
                    
                        Curso JavaScript: classes e heranças no desenvolvimento de aplicações com orientação a objetos
- 
            
                
                
                
                
                    
                        Artigo Um guia para importação e exportação de módulos com JavaScript | Alura
- 
            
                
                
                
                
                    
                        Artigo Node.JS: definição, características, vantagens e usos possíveis
- 
            
                
                
                
                
                    
                        Artigo Novidades do Node.js (versão 18) | Alura
- 
            
                
                
                
                
                    
                        Podcast Node.js – Hipsters #199
- 
            
                
                
                
                
                    
                        Artigo Postman: saiba como instalar e dar seus primeiros passos
- 
            
                
                
                
                
                    
                        Formação APIs com Node.js e Express
- 
            
                
                
                
                
                    
                        Formação Autenticação, testes e segurança em Node.js
- 
            
                
                
                
                
                    
                        Formação Aprofunde em Node.js com arquitetura Serverless
 
- 
            
                
                
                
                
                    
                        
